One of the leading causes of desk rejections is scope misalignment, which ranks high among the reasons for desk rejections. In the case of journal paper publication for the New Zealand region, consider: Journals that publish NZ-focused research, Asia-Pacific regional journals, International journals that welcome regional case studies
Example: NZ Contextual Research
A public health paper focusing on Māori health outcomes might be more suitable for a regional health journal or a journal with indigenous research priorities

Metrics vs Meaning
While high-impact metrics are important, regional relevance may also play an equally important role for the publication of a research paper in NZ.
Open access journals also offer the advantage of greater visibility and downloads. Piwowar et al. (2018) discovered that open access articles receive a citation advantage over paywalled articles.
In the context of scientific journal publication services offered in NZ, the following should be considered:
Open access can be especially beneficial for research with public policy or environmental relevance in New Zealand.

Ethical transparency has now become a standard expectation in academic publishing. Research journals, both in New Zealand and worldwide, require strict standards of research integrity to be met. Prior to submitting a manuscript, it is essential to ensure that the manuscript demonstrates the following:
If a manuscript fails to meet ethical standards, it may be rejected immediately, irrespective of the quality of the research. For researchers seeking to publish in New Zealand, it is important to demonstrate alignment to ethical standards to gain greater credibility in the peer review process.
